BOWLING GREEN, Ky. – Coming off of their third-straight loss, the Campbellsville University football team had an individual standout in wide receiver/punter Tate Pringle as Pringle was named the Mid-South Conference Special Teams Player of the Week.
 
Pringle was limited as a receiver but scored the only Tiger touchdown of the game against University of the Cumberlands on a special teams play while also punting the ball nine times for an average of 39 yards per punt.
 
He scored the touchdown on a 70-yard fake punt run to give CU a 7-6 lead at the time. From then on Pringle, punted those nine times with a long punt of 45 yards with one punt being pinned inside of the 20 yard line.
 
It is the second weekly honor for Pringle this season as he was named the NCCAA Student-Athlete of the Week for his week one performance against Thomas More as a wide receiver.
 
Campbellsville has an off week this week before playing their regular season home finale next Thursday when they host Lindsey Wilson College.
